The dimensions of a badminton court are 20 ft x 44 ft (6.1 m x 13.4 m), an area of 880 ft2 (81.75 m2). We will look into all of this in detail, including the entire area of a badminton court and its surroundings. The net divides the court in half,. Badminton courts have a length of 44’ (13.4 m), but double courts are 20’ (6.1 m) wide while single courts are reduced to 17’ (5.18 m); The official dimensions of a standard badminton court are 20 feet wide by 44 feet long, or 6.1 meters wide by 13.4 meters long. The diagonal length of the full court is 48.30 ft (14.72 m).
